Background / History

Ace began as a highly methodical magical researcher concerned that his early spell repertoire lacked close-combat, defensive, mobility, and finishing options. He sought to compensate through rune research, improved spell models, experimentation, and eventually martial techniques. 28 60

He adopted alternate identities to separate his research and public actions from his true name. As Sharp, he experienced the freedom of role-playing another life; as Iron Masked Fire Fist, he hunted demonic beasts, gained recognition among caravans and demon hunters, and acquired experimental materials. 47 111

After reaching the Northern Territory, Ace developed a network of contracted wizard apprentices. He used magical contracts, magic books, suggestion-like spells, and a radiating mental network to organize survivors fleeing persecution by the city-states. He planned and led their migration into the Lar Mountains, where he intended to establish a wizard academy, a magic town, and eventually a lasting magical society. 127 140 150 171 179

As the High Tower developed, Ace increasingly combined research with governance. He promoted apprentices, founded academic institutions, directed magical production and education, formed alliances, and expanded the influence of wizard civilization. 261 291 393 558

His later advancement centered on dream, manifestation, fate, divine authority, and the magic net. He established a dream-based divine foundation, created Authority Treasure Tools for major realms, united deities under the Salia Alliance, and ultimately became a Ten Rings Wizard. 445 516 559 586 600

Personality

Ace is driven above all by the pursuit of knowledge. He treats magical phenomena, artifacts, living beings, and even deities as subjects worthy of study, while remaining conscious that certain research carries severe risks. 53 347

He is strategic, patient, and highly pragmatic. Ace routinely uses disguises, contracts, charms, magical suggestion, memory alteration, and carefully constructed public displays to protect his organization and shape outcomes. He explicitly places greater trust in spells and systems than in human goodwill. 140 144 347 409

Despite his utilitarian methods, Ace maintains a personal bottom line and repeatedly takes responsibility for those who follow him. He spared hostile shamans, resolved Ansesta and Arno's meditation problems, protected apprentices during crises, and prioritized the High Tower’s safety when his own presence would endanger it. 90 197 268

His deepest desires are identified as greed for knowledge and arrogance in research; he consciously uses both as fuel for his Heart Flame and advancement. 315

Abilities & Skills

Rune and Spell Research

Ace is an exceptional rune researcher capable of deciphering, reverse-engineering, modifying, and constructing spell models across multiple magical systems.

  • Deciphered more than a dozen soul runes from royal marvels despite the limits of his perception. 50
  • Reverse-engineered water-element soul runes to improve recovery magic. 118 120
  • Developed the Rune Rule Degradation Hypothesis from his study of the Soul Secret Treasury Space. 241
  • Deduced Level 3 dream and manifestation runes after reaching Legendary level. 445
  • Pursued high-level spacetime and law runes as a Titan Sovereign. 639

Soul, Dream, and Mindscape Magic

Ace’s primary foundation is dream-based magic, centered on his Soul Secret Treasury Space, True Spirit, subconscious sea, and Mindscape.

  • Created a dream clone to oversee the nascent subconscious sea rather than merging with it. 235
  • Can control multiple bodies through his True Spirit, though doing so causes severe fatigue. 261
  • Created the Limited Time Mirror Technique, producing a temporary clone with one-twentieth of his strength. 261
  • Can manifest mental imagery over reality for a short time. 330
  • Remolded Alesha’s memories and implanted subconscious loyalty through repeated dream lives. 347
  • Built and later dominated a magic net connected to the dreamscape. 586

Heart Flame and Warrior Research

Ace researches the interaction of willpower, Heart Power, virtue runes, and martial cultivation.

  • Created the dangerous Courage Rune, which can strengthen mortals but harmed or killed unsuitable apprentice-level subjects. 197
  • Determined that mimicked Courage Runes and mimicked Heart Power both strongly resist mental control. 197
  • Used his research to restore Ansesta and Arno’s ability to meditate. 197
  • Ignited his Heart Flame through the Willfire Seed and used it to refine heterogeneous magic power. 315
  • Passed the perfected Blood Energy and Heart Flame path to Luna. 568

Mental Influence and Control

Ace possesses numerous methods for influencing perception, emotion, memory, and loyalty.

  • Uses charm spells to control individuals and gather intelligence. 111
  • Creates suggestion-like effects by simulating induction, sympathy, and will runes; these amplify emotions already present rather than directly replacing them. 140
  • Conducts loyalty checks through illusion and charm effects. 140
  • Employs pseudo-suggestion to inspire awe and trust during public appearances. 146
  • Can immobilize targets with the third-ring Eye of Fear. 411
